04:31 AM EDT, 08/29/2024 (MT Newswires) -- Microsoft ( MSFT ) -backed OpenAI is in talks with venture capitalists to raise billions of dollars in a new funding round that could value the company at more than $100 billion, The Wall Street Journal reported Wednesday, citing unnamed people familiar with the matter.
Joshua Kushner's Thrive Capital is leading the investment round with about $1 billion and will be the biggest funding round since Microsoft ( MSFT ) invested $10 billion in the ChatGPT maker in early 2023, the news outlet reported.
It could not be determined what other investors are participating in the funding round, The Journal said.
OpenAI and Thrive did not immediately respond to MT Newswires' requests for comment.
